素数
-
c++如何判断一个数是否为素数_C++判断质数的几种算法
基础试除法:判断2到n-1是否能整除n;2. 优化试除法:只需检查2到√n;3. 跳过偶数:大于2的偶数非素数;4. 埃拉托斯特尼筛法:批量求素数高效。 判断一个数是否为素数(质数)是C++编程中常见的问题。素数是指大于1且只能被1和自身整除的自然数。下面介绍几种常用的算法,从简单到高效,适用于不同…
-
如何用c语言输出100到200之间的素数
分析: 首先找出100~200以内的所有整数,再让这些整数对除了1和它本身以外的数求余,如果有能整除的就不是素数,否则就为素数。 代码实现: #includeint main(){int conut = 0;int i = 0;for(i=100; i<=200; i++) //先找出来100…
-
如何使用Python实现素数判断的算法?
如何使用Python实现素数判断的算法? 素数是指只能被1和自身整除的正整数,例如2、3、5、7等。素数的判断是一个常见的算法问题,本文将介绍如何使用Python编写一个简单且高效的素数判断算法。 首先,我们需要明确判断素数的条件。对于一个正整数n,如果存在一个数k,满足2 接下来,我们就可以编写代…
-
javascript怎么求素数
求素数的方法:1、遍历1~n区间中的所有自然数给n来除,若余数为0则表示该数n不是素数,否则就是素数,语法“for(i=2;i<n;i++){if(n%i===0){return false;}}”。2、利用素数平方根范围,语法“for(i=2;i<=Math.sqrt(n);i++){…